MOTOR CAMP AT TAHUNA
SITE SUGGESTED BY CITY COUNCIL The Nelson City Council recently took up the matter of providing a motor camping ground at Tahuna beach and at last night’s meeting the Committee of the Whole Council reported that it had visited the beach and recommended that a site be reserved for a camping ground to the north-west of the Dlodel Yacht Pond, ancl that the proposal be submitted to the Tahuna Sands Association for its consideration and with a view to making arrangements for supervision. The Dlayor (Dir G. L. Page) said the committee had suggested that site as it would be near to the dressing sheds, the present conveniences could be used, and the T.S.A. attendant could collect the fees and generally supervise the ground.
